What it is

Alita is one of Lithuania’s best-known sparkling wines, produced by AB Alita in Alytus. Made by the Charmat method — secondary fermentation in pressurised tanks for at least 30 days — this semi-dry white sparkling wine draws on quality Italian white wine material and delivers fine, persistent bubbles with a gently off-dry palate.

Pale gold in the glass, with a nose of ripe peach, green apple, and a whisper of vanilla. The palate is fresh and lively, with a clean finish that works equally well as an aperitif or alongside light desserts and soft cheeses.
